Carlsbad homes and what they need

Carlsbad Village work concentrates on persistent marine-humidity-driven slow losses, mold remediation in compromised wall cavities of older homes, and coordination with several Village-area plumbers on aging copper re-pipe scope when failures are part of a pattern rather than isolated.

Neighborhoods we cover for rental water damage in Carlsbad: Carlsbad Village, Olde Carlsbad, La Costa, Aviara, Bressi Ranch, Calavera Hills, La Costa Valley, Carlsbad Highlands.

Carlsbad mixes older 1950s-70s Village stock on aging copper, mid-80s tract through La Costa now hitting prime slab-leak window, and newer 2000s+ master-plan construction in Aviara, Bressi Ranch, and Calavera Hills. Marine-moisture mold work in the Village; slab leaks in the older tract; appliance and supply-line failures in the newer master-plan stock.

What rental water damage usually involves

  • Tenant duty to report and limit further damage
  • Landlord dwelling policy versus renters insurance
  • Unit-to-unit ceiling releases in multi-family
  • Habitability and temporary housing questions for the insurer
  • Cause-of-loss notes that reduce dispute later
  • Direct billing when the dwelling carrier approves mitigation
